Software for systems

Based on its purpose, the software that runs your system provides a platform for other programs to run. The application software is designed with specific purposes for the end user. Examples of application software include word processors, multimedia players, and web browsers.

System software can fall into three categories that include operating systems, application programs, in addition to utility software. The latter can be programs that help to maintain and control a computer.

The operating system is the primary component of any computer. It is accountable for managing memory, deciphering devices that input or output, and allocating resources across various processes. It also helps manage the hardware that is connected to the computer. The OS analyzes every process that occurs in the system . It records the results. It allocates resources to every process in accordance with the order of priority. The OS also monitors memory usage and prevents access from unauthorized sources.

Application programs are programs written in a custom way designed to carry out the task for which they are designed. They are usually written in general-purpose languages for instance, C. The applications are then translated into Low-level executable machine-code.

Driver software

Choosing the right driver for your system is crucial due to a variety of reasons. The computer running an unsuitable driver may suffer issues with performance, crashes or even shutdowns.

A device driver is a component of software that connects with the hardware attached to your computer. It provides I/O, performs error-handling, and allows your device to operate properly.

A device driver may also communicate with storage, graphics, and the mouse. They are usually included in the dynamic link library file.

It is tiny bit of software that acts as translator between your computer's operating system and components of your personal computer. It does so by translating software used for general-purpose use into exact instructions for you hardware. Malicious software

Sometimes, they are referred to as malware often, malicious software is programmers that aim to harm the system of your computer or to steal your private information. Some examples of malware comprise trojans, Trojans or even worms. It's crucial to be aware of the distinction between these types of software so that you can avoid getting infected.

The virus is a program that infects your system or network and can corrupt or erase data and locking users out of their system. These types of software are designed to spread rapidly. They are typically contained within an executable file, but they can also be found in fileless forms of malware.

By using the internet, dangerous programs can be downloaded to your computer through email attachments, harmful websites and even through downloading virus-ridden programs. Occasionally, it can be transferred via an infected USB stick. If you think you have a virus, you can clean it out of your computer in a safe mode.

Usually, a worm will replicate itself by infecting additional computers in that same network. It copies its memory on every computer it attacks. These files are then copied across the networks, causing your systems to be susceptible to attacks from other hackers.

Trojans are fake software programs that pretend to be legitimate software. They're malicious as they steal your personal information, or cause your system to malfunction. They're most commonly downloaded through email attachments.
